U.S. prescription drug spending reached $806 billion in 2024—a $50 billion jump and a 10.2% year-over-year increase. High-cost categories like GLP-1s and oncology therapies are driving much of the growth, and health plans are feeling the pressure from all sides. Member groups are demanding more support, better transparency, and relief from cost surprises.

The question most plans are asking isn't whether to act—it's how to act without starting from zero.


The Shift: From Monolithic to Modular


While most health plans aren't changing their PBM relationships outright, nearly all are revisiting how they manage pharmacy costs and engage members. The emerging strategy? Building ecosystems of specialized partners rather than relying solely on a single all-in-one PBM solution.


This modular approach allows plans to layer in capabilities around fulfillment, cost transparency, clinical insight, and member navigation—without requiring a full operational overhaul. It's an incremental evolution that addresses urgent gaps while preserving what's already working.
